A 1 15 4
B 2 14 5
C 3 13 6
D 4 12 4
我想把第2列(1+2+3+4)和第3列(15+14+13+12)加起来,最后加在一起,而忽略第1列和第4列。我怎样才能完成这个任务?
将第1、3列和1+3列相加
awk 'BEGIN {FS = " "} ; {sum+=$2} {sum2+=$3} END {print sum, sum2, sum+sum2}' file
你可以试试下面。
awk 'BEGIN {FS = " "} ; {sum+=$2} {sum1+=$3} END {print sum sum1}' file.txt